Southbound Copeland Avenue in La Crosse reduced to one lane starting Monday
LA CROSSE (WKBT) — Copeland Avenue in La Crosse will be reduced to one lane for utility work beginning Monday.
The southbound lane from Car Street shortly past Causeway Boulevard will be closed. The right lane will be closed first. In the second portion of the project, the right lane will open and crews will close the left lane. Officials urge caution for motorists heading south while work is taking place.
